Is there a way to pause and resume the test runner ? Something like
asyncTest in QUnit (http://docs.jquery.com/QUnit/asyncTest) or start/
stop methods in the Unit Test suite of SproutCore (http://
wiki.sproutcore.com/UnitTesting-Writing+Unit+Tests).
I need this to make async tests (pausing the test runner until
everything is ready and next resuming).
